About

Angelo Del Sole is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Psychiatry and Mental health. According to data from OpenAlex, Angelo Del Sole has authored 60 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 29 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, 11 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 10 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health. Recurrent topics in Angelo Del Sole’s work include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(18 papers), Advanced MRI Techniques and Applications (11 papers) and Cardiac Imaging and Diagnostics (7 papers). Angelo Del Sole is often cited by papers focused on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(18 papers), Advanced MRI Techniques and Applications (11 papers) and Cardiac Imaging and Diagnostics (7 papers). Angelo Del Sole coll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and Switzerland. Angelo Del Sole's co-authors include Giovanni Lucignani, Ferruccio Fazio, Michela Lecchi, Luca Tagliabue, Daniela Perani, Francesca Clerici, Marzia Lecchi, C. Messa, Arturo Chiti and Laura Maggiore and has published in prestigious journals such as American Journal of Psychiatry, NeuroImage and Journal of Neurology Neurosurgery & Psychiatry.
